What Are Botox and Dermal Fillers? (The Simple Explanation)
Think of aging like two different problems happening to your face: movement wrinkles and volume loss. Botox and dermal fillers tackle these issues in completely different ways.
Botox: The Muscle Relaxer Botox works like a gentle “pause button” for the muscles that create expression lines. When you smile, frown, or squint, certain muscles contract and create creases. Over time, these temporary creases become permanent wrinkles. Botox temporarily relaxes these muscles, giving your skin a chance to smooth out.
Think of it this way: if your face were a piece of paper, Botox stops you from folding it in the same places over and over again.
Dermal Fillers: The Volume Restorer Dermal fillers are like adding cushioning back to areas that have lost their plumpness. As we age, we naturally lose fat and collagen in our faces, causing areas like our cheeks and lips to appear hollow or sunken. Fillers – most commonly made with hyaluronic acid (a substance naturally found in your body) – add volume back to these areas.
Using the same paper analogy: fillers are like adding padding underneath the paper to smooth out dents and restore its original shape.
Botox vs Fillers: Which Problems Do They Actually Solve?
Botox is Your Go-To For:
- Forehead lines – Those horizontal lines that appear when you raise your eyebrows
- Crow’s feet – The little lines around your eyes when you smile or squint
- Frown lines – The “11” lines between your eyebrows
- Prevention – Stopping wrinkles before they become permanent (great for people in their 20s and 30s!)
Dermal Fillers Excel At:
- Lip enhancement – Adding volume or defining the lip border
- Cheek restoration – Bringing back that youthful fullness
- Under-eye hollows – Reducing the tired, sunken appearance
- Nasolabial folds – Those lines that run from your nose to the corners of your mouth
- Jawline definition – Creating a more sculpted profile
The Real Talk: What to Expect
How Long Do Results Last?
- Botox: 3-6 months on average. Many of our Tempe patients find they can go longer between treatments as their muscles “learn” to relax.
- Dermal Fillers: 6 months to 2 years, depending on the type used and where it’s placed. Areas that move more (like lips) typically don’t last as long as cheeks.
Does It Hurt? Let’s be honest – there are needles involved, so there’s some discomfort. However, most people describe it as a quick pinch. Our experienced nursing staff at Gateway Health uses techniques to minimize discomfort, and many fillers now contain numbing agents.
When Will I See Results?
- Botox: You’ll start noticing changes in 3-5 days, with full results visible in about 2 weeks.
- Fillers: Results are immediate, though you may have some initial swelling that settles within a few days.

Your Treatment Day: What Actually Happens
Before Your Appointment:
- Avoid alcohol and blood-thinning medications for a few days if possible
- Come with a clean face (no makeup)
- Bring photos of your desired results for reference
During Treatment:
- We’ll discuss your goals and examine your face
- The injection process typically takes 15-30 minutes
- You can return to most normal activities immediately
After Treatment:
- Avoid touching the treated areas for 24 hours
- Skip intense workouts for 24-48 hours
- Sleep elevated the first night to minimize swelling
- Stay hydrated and follow our specific aftercare instructions
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I get both Botox and fillers at the same time? Absolutely! Many patients combine treatments for comprehensive results. We often call this a “liquid facelift.”
Will I look “frozen” or unnatural? Not when done correctly! Our goal is to enhance your natural features, not change who you are. You should still look like yourself – just refreshed.
What if I don’t like the results? Botox will gradually wear off if you’re unhappy. Some fillers can be dissolved with an enzyme if needed, though this is rarely necessary.
